The hexadecimal color code #1E301D corresponds to the code RGB( 30, 48, 29 ). It's a shade of Green. This color is a combination of red (at 0,12 level), green (at 0,19 level) and blue (at 0,11 level). Its brightness is 15% and its saturation is 24%. It is composed of red at 28%, green at 44% and blue at 27%.
